This position will be based on a biopharmaceutical site on behalf of our client, a multinational and multicultural company which provides great career progression opportunities to the right person.
Responsibilities- Work as part of the utilities team and plan work activities in line with maintenance and Process schedule.
- Assist in commissioning activities, Project support and Equipment Vendor Maintenance.
- Work with the Utilities Department and Engineering Department to plan and schedule the required Maintenance activities.
- Manage and support service or equipment vendors when undertaking Maintenance as required to ensure that applicable standards are adhered to.
- Liaise with discipline leads to coordinate activities for efficient execution of Maintenance activities.
- Ensure all PTW and mechanical isolations are in place to perform maintenance works related to mechanical Utilities.
- Develop cost saving and energy reduction initiatives on utilities systems.
- Updating GMP maintenance documents and drawings to reflect any changes required and to improve operation of maintenance activities.
- Conduct corrective and preventative maintenance on all operational equipment.
- Proactively solve to ensure that operational issues are solved permanently.
- Ensure corrective action is taken, as required, for all equipment and operational problems to drive continuous improvement in the Plant.
- Plan and develop maintenance plans where required.
- Operate and Maintain utility systems.
- Respond to any request from operations for utility related issues.
- Apprenticeship or 3rd Level qualification with Mechanical Experience.
- Minimum of 3 years' experience in Mechanical utilities or process maintenance.
- Must have experience working within the Pharmaceutical or Biologics industry.
- Strong practical Mechanical knowledge.
- Execution of mechanical preventative and corrective maintenance tasks on production systems and equipment, such as pumps, autoclaves, inspection machines, etc within the production area.
- Supporting both the electrical and calibration departments within the production area.
- Follow all relevant SOPs and procedures when completing maintenance tasks.
- Ensure all works executed are recorded on the relevant CMMS systems.
- Acute awareness of GMP practices.
- Ability to read mechanical drawings and system P&ID's.
- Maintain all documentation in an organised and controlled manner, in compliance with client procedures.
- Attend daily meeting and provide status updates.
- Have excellent troubleshooting and problem-solving skills, which above all, pose no risk to health and secondly provide no potential risk to any systems.
